Fueled largely by resource development mega-projects, Labrador has begun an economic renaissance in recent years. Its strategic northern location and remarkable environment ensure it will be a key destination for several industries in the near and distant future. The Labrador North Chamber of Commerce has been operating an event management service for northern events, including the Northern Lights trade conference, for many years. It was time for them to develop an event management brand that would better capitalize on Labrador’s potential as a meetings and conventions destination. They chose us to help develop a dynamic new brand, as well as an integrated marketing and communications plan to help them reach a global market.

In consultation with the Chamber, we developed the brand Venture North to help position both the event management team, as well as the destination. The saying goes, “nothing ventured, nothing gained,” and we wanted to communicate that a trip to Labrador will create experiences that leave people changed.

A logo that used key environmental features helped properly represent these experiences, while professional fonts and colours made the brand relevant for meetings and conventions planners. Our communications and marketing plan keyed in on developing critical industry partnerships and alliances, while using strategic publicity and promotions to get the most buzz for their buck.

The result is a brand that positions this organization for bigger and better things. Focused on their key strengths of location, environment, culture and people, Venture North has the potential to be an economic driver for the region by increasing tourism traffic and prompting infrastructure expansion to meet demand.
